            <description><![CDATA[Sonic is the first external project to join Psychedelic to provide an AMM/DeFi suite to the Internet Computer ecosystem 🚀Today we’re excited to announce that Psychedelic is growing! As of today, the DFinance project is now part of Psychedelic, joining Plug, Dank, DAB, CAP, and all other future projects. Being one of the first DeFi platforms coming to the Internet Computer, this move seeks to significantly strengthen the Sonic project (formerly known as DFinance) by bringing their team into t...]]></description>
